A MAN accused of causing the deaths of two girls in a car crash appeared at Bournemouth Crown Court yesterday.
Lily Butterfield-Godwin and Abbey Rogers, both 19 and from the New Forest, died after the car they were travelling in crashed into a wall in Gosport Lane, Lyndhurst, on December 13 last year.
James Battrick, of Old Romsey Road, Cadnam, is charged with two counts of causing death by careless driving while unfit through drugs, two counts of causing death by careless driving while over the prescribed limit of alcohol, and one count of possessing cannabis.
The 21-year-old, who appeared in court using crutches with a medical brace on his leg, spoke only to confirm his name.
He was released on bail to return to court for a plea and case management hearing on August 7.
